A 7"x9" glass plate negative of a 17th century carved chair with three carved crowns on back and one on leg support. Not yet identified but similar to chairs in King Charles's Dining Room, Windsor. It is RCIN 45932-34.
Provenance
Commissioned by the Royal Collection for inventory purposes
